#2b1f45 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b1f45 is composed of 16.9% red, 12.2%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.7% cyan, 55.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 72.9% black. It has a hue angle of 258.9 degrees, a saturation of 38% and a lightness of 19.6%. #2b1f45 color hex could be obtained by blending #563e8a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#2b1f45 color description : Very dark desaturated violet.
#2b1f45 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2b1f45 has RGB values of R:43, G:31,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 2826053.
